* tree-pass.h (ipa_opt_pass_d): Rename function_read_summary;
authorhubicka <hubicka@138bc75d-0d04-0410-961f-82ee72b054a4>
Wed, 21 Apr 2010 17:44:03 +0000 (17:44 +0000)
committerhubicka <hubicka@138bc75d-0d04-0410-961f-82ee72b054a4>
Wed, 21 Apr 2010 17:44:03 +0000 (17:44 +0000)
add write_optimization_summary, read_optimization_summary.
(ipa_write_summaries_of_cgraph_node_set): Remove.
(ipa_write_optimization_summaries): Declare.
(ipa_read_optimization_summaries): Declare.
* ipa-cp.c (pass_ipa_cp): Update.
* ipa-reference.c (pass_ipa_reference): Update.
* ipa-pure-const.c (pass_ipa_pure_const): Update.
* lto-streamer-out.c (pass_ipa_lto_gimple, pass_ipa_lto_finish):
Update.
* ipa-inline.c (pass_ipa_inline): Update.
* ipa.c (pass_ipa_whole_program): Update.
* lto-wpa-fixup.c (pass_ipa_lto_wpa_fixup): Update.
* passes.c (ipa_write_summaries_1): Do not test wpa.
(ipa_write_optimization_summaries_1): New.
(ipa_write_optimization_summaries): New.
(ipa_read_summaries): Do not test ltrans.
(ipa_read_optimization_summaries_1): New.
(ipa_read_optimization_summaries): New.

* lto.c (lto_wpa_write_files): Update.
(read_cgraph_and_symbols): Be more verbose.
(materialize_cgraph): Likewise.
(do_whole_program_analysis): Likewise.
